Transaction 35ffaed863211a97ccdd4c7b188e18d6a8019b6d8cc933dc4a8a63f70494fa6d

1 Input
2 Outputs
  • 35ffaed863211a97ccdd4c7b188e18d6a8019b6d8cc933dc4a8a63f70494fa6d:0
  • value  34597169108
    address  331jK44HRCFkQXkWLkwvA7Bh23preQwSbb
  • 35ffaed863211a97ccdd4c7b188e18d6a8019b6d8cc933dc4a8a63f70494fa6d:1
  • value  4110000
    address  3BYmMc9PaghbNDsKqKtk7JEcZ231oB5f3u